thetrainfan wrote:Unfortunately not Dave.DaveDewhurst wrote:Oooh,
I might have to re-download mine (Voyager especially)
If someone gets it soon, has the light issue on the voyager been fixed?
ie if you have a double consist, the front head lights of the forward facing middle unit stay on, looks very odd.
Dave (yes I'm being lazy I could check myself)
On two VT 221s, when I enter leading cab, and put into Forward and select Daytime running lights (actually it is the same with any light position):
Both inner lights stay on daytime mode. Rearmost lights are in the normal tail position.
On two CrossCountry 221s, enter leading cab, Forward and daytime lights (again same for any position):
Front unit's inner lights are again in daytime mode but the rear unit's inner lights are tails. Weirdly the rearmost lights on the rear unit are daytime mode too!
